The area of triangle ABC is divided into four equal parts by segments parallel to the base BC. DC is 36 cm. A is the top point of the triangle.

What is the ratio of the dimensions of triangle ADE to the dimensions of triangle ABC?

Answers

Notice you have similar triangles.

In more than one of your previous posts, I have shown you that the
areas of similar shapes are proportional to the SQUARES of their corresponding sides.

Apply that principle here.
